AI Summary
-
Exempts retired New Hampshire retirement system members from the mandatory 28-day waiting period before starting part-time employment if they were already working part-time for a different employer at the time of retirement
-
Clarifies that hours worked during governor-declared emergencies or under the direction of the division of forests and lands for woodland fire control do not count toward the 1,352-hour annual limit for part-time retiree employment
-
Maintains the existing 28-day waiting period and 1,352-hour annual cap for retirees who were not concurrently employed part-time elsewhere at retirement
-
Takes effect 60 days after passage
Legislative Description
Exempting certain retirees from the 28-day waiting period for part-time employment.
